Fancy Company Chicken

Prep: 15 min Cook: 50 min Serves: 6 Cuisine: American

A hearty, cheesy chicken bake with mushrooms and herbs, topped with stuffing and butter, perfect for family dinners and comforting gatherings.

Ingredients

  • 6 boneless chicken breasts
  • 6 slices Swiss cheese
  • 1/4 lb. sliced mushrooms
  • 1/2 cup butter
  • 1 can chicken soup
  • 1/2 can white wine
  • 1 small package Pepperidge Farm herb stuffing

Instructions

  1. Grease a 9 x 13-inch glass baking dish.
  2. Place the chicken breasts in the bottom of the dish.
  3. Lay a slice of Swiss cheese on each chicken breast.
  4. Layer sliced mushrooms over the cheese.
  5. Mix the chicken soup and white wine, then pour the mixture over the chicken and mushrooms.
  6. Spread the Pepperidge Farm herb stuffing evenly over the soup mixture.
  7. Drizzle melted butter over the stuffing.
  8. Bake in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for 45 to 50 minutes until cooked through and golden.

Tips & Substitutions

For a lighter version, consider using low-fat Swiss cheese and reduced-sodium chicken soup. If you don't have white wine, chicken broth can be a good substitute. For added flavor, sauté the mushrooms in a bit of butter before layering them. This dish can also be made ahead of time and refrigerated before baking, making it perfect for entertaining.

Serving Suggestions

This Fancy Company Chicken pairs beautifully with a fresh salad or steamed vegetables for a balanced meal. For a heartier side, serve with mashed potatoes or rice to soak up the flavorful sauce. Storage & Reheating

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, place in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 20 minutes, or until warmed through. You can also microwave individual portions, but be sure to cover them to prevent drying out.

Nutrition & Diet Analysis (per serving)

Each serving of Fancy Company Chicken contains roughly 485 calories, with 29g protein, 3g carbohydrates, and 34g fat. It is an excellent source of protein (57% of the Daily Value) and vitamin D (27% of the Daily Value), and a good source of calcium and vitamin A. Note that it is relatively high in sodium, at 834mg per serving (36% of the Daily Value).

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use different types of cheese for this recipe?

Yes, you can substitute Swiss cheese with other varieties like provolone or mozzarella, depending on your taste preference. Each cheese will impart a different flavor, so feel free to experiment. Just ensure the cheese melts well to achieve that creamy texture on top.

What can I serve with Fancy Company Chicken?

This dish is versatile and pairs well with a variety of sides. Consider serving it with roasted vegetables, a crisp green salad, or garlic bread. For a comforting touch, creamy mashed potatoes or wild rice with almonds would complement the flavors nicely.

Can I freeze this dish before baking?

Absolutely! You can prepare the dish up to the point of baking, then cover it tightly and freeze. When ready to cook, thaw it in the refrigerator overnight and bake as directed. This makes it a convenient make-ahead meal for busy nights or special occasions.
